Charter 60ft Sea Ray Private Yacht
Enjoy a luxurious & unforgettable escape from the bustling streets of Miami on Motor Yacht Another Chance II
60ft Length Overall, 14 ft. Zodiac Tender, Spacious and Air Conditioned Exterior Cockpit, Bow reclining lounge cushions and speakers, Full galley and salon, two well appointed staterooms each with own head and shower, Bose audio entertainment system throughout entire boat, Bluetooth for music, XM/Sirius Radio, Water toys, Top of the line Fishing gear, Snorkel Gear.
$3,000 Day/Overnight at dock. Up to 6 guests.
$2800 half day (4 hour cruise). Up to 12 guests. (Customary 15-20% crew gratuity not included).
$3800 full day (8 hour cruise). Up to 12 guests. (Customary 15-20% crew gratuity not included).

About the area
Miami
Located on the waterfront, this houseboat is in Downtown Miami, a neighbourhood in Miami. Vizcaya Museum and Gardens and Art Deco Historic District are notable land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Bayfront Park and Biscayne National Park. Looking to enjoy an event or a game? See what's going on at Kaseya Center or LoanDepot Park. Jet skiing and scuba diving off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with hunting and ecotours nearby.
